About the Operations Team

Every day, students from 175 nationalities book over 5000 nights across 33 cities on uniplaces.com.

Our diverse team, representing 14 nationalities and speaking 6 languages, is dedicated to improving the student and landlord experience. We aim to make finding a room as easy as booking a flight.

Join us as a Customer Experience Intern!
In this exciting role, you'll be responsible for delivering high-quality support to both tenants and landlords throughout their bookings journey. You'll assist customers with inquiries, bookings changes, cancellations, refunds, payment-related issues, and conflict resolution, ensuring a smooth and positive customer experience.
You'll also play an active roe in supporting internal operations and contributing to process improvements within the Customer Experience Team.
What You'll Do
  • Provide exceptional customer support to tenants and landlords through various communication channels, identifying issues and delivering timely solutions.
  • Assist with booking modifications, cancellations, refunds, and discounts, while proactively managing landlord cancellations to enhance tenant experiences and protect company revenue.
  • Mediate and resolve conflicts between customers professionally and empathetically.
  • Create and update help tickets to accurately document customer interactions.
  • Communicate proactively with customers to ensure accurate booking and listing information.
  • Collaborate with different teams to improve internal processes and engage in customer-focused projects.

Important details
  • This is a remote-based role.

  • Internship contract with a duration of 3-months (August, September and October).

  • Includes an internship grant + meal allowance + eligible for monthly bonus.

  • Access to a co-working office in Lisbon, Monday to Friday.

  • Requires availability of 40H per week.
